Abstract

The article is based on two inventories and the balance sheet documentation of the shop run in Warsaw by  Jean-Joseph Chaudoir (1746–1839) and his brother Jacques Hubert (1753–1794), French-language merchants who came to Warsaw in 1774 and c. 1783, respectively.  It discusses the offer of the shop (the range of goods sold and their prices), the origin of the goods, the Chaudoirs’ network of trade contacts, the clientele and the range of income.
